7
© 2002 IBM Corporation Confidential | Date | Other Information, if necessary Parallel Tools Platform Project Move Review Greg Watson Beth Tibbitts December 2006

© 2002 IBM Corporation Confidential | Date | Other Information, if necessary Parallel Tools Platform Project Move Review Greg Watson Beth Tibbitts December

Embed Size (px)

Citation preview

Page 1: © 2002 IBM Corporation Confidential | Date | Other Information, if necessary Parallel Tools Platform Project Move Review Greg Watson Beth Tibbitts December

© 2002 IBM Corporation

Confidential | Date | Other Information, if necessary

Parallel Tools Platform ProjectMove Review

Greg WatsonBeth TibbittsDecember 2006

Page 2: © 2002 IBM Corporation Confidential | Date | Other Information, if necessary Parallel Tools Platform Project Move Review Greg Watson Beth Tibbitts December

Eclipse Foundation, Inc. 2

Introduction

The proposal is to move the Parallel Tools Platform (PTP) project from the Technology PMC to the Tools PMC. The following slides describe the background and rationale.

Page 3: © 2002 IBM Corporation Confidential | Date | Other Information, if necessary Parallel Tools Platform Project Move Review Greg Watson Beth Tibbitts December

Eclipse Foundation, Inc. 3

Background

Created as an Eclipse technology project in 2005 to simplify the development of parallel programs

Provides a generic interface for launching, controlling and monitoring programs on arbitrary parallel computing systems

Provides the only open-source parallel debugger currently available Provides static analysis tools to aid in the development of MPI and

OpenMP programs

Page 4: © 2002 IBM Corporation Confidential | Date | Other Information, if necessary Parallel Tools Platform Project Move Review Greg Watson Beth Tibbitts December

Eclipse Foundation, Inc. 4

Reasons for moving

Maturity No longer a technology incubator project

Growing community Monthly meetings regularly attract 10+ participants

Increasing number of contributors

Contributions from non-core participants

Ad-hoc parallel performance tools group formed Regular release planning and deliverables

V1.0 released in 2Q06

V1.1 planned for 4Q06

V2.0 planned for 2Q07

Page 5: © 2002 IBM Corporation Confidential | Date | Other Information, if necessary Parallel Tools Platform Project Move Review Greg Watson Beth Tibbitts December

Eclipse Foundation, Inc. 5

Reasons for moving

Better alignment with Tools charter The Eclipse Tools Project encompasses the tools being built for the

Eclipse Platform. The main focus of these tools will be development tools such as computer programming language tools (compilers, editors, debuggers), performance tools, and test tools.

Close collaboration with CDT project Both share static analysis infrastructure

C/C++ and Fortran essential to parallel application development

Both CDT and PTP will need to support multicore in the future

Page 6: © 2002 IBM Corporation Confidential | Date | Other Information, if necessary Parallel Tools Platform Project Move Review Greg Watson Beth Tibbitts December

Eclipse Foundation, Inc. 6

Organization

Project lead Greg Watson (LANL)

Committers Beth Tibbitts (IBM)

Craig Rasmussen (LANL)

Randy Roberts (LANL)

Clement Chu (Monash)

Tianchao Li (TUM) Contributors

Wyatt Spear (Oregon)

Don Pazel (Google)

Page 7: © 2002 IBM Corporation Confidential | Date | Other Information, if necessary Parallel Tools Platform Project Move Review Greg Watson Beth Tibbitts December

Eclipse Foundation, Inc. 7

Questions?